What is the First Grade Benchmark Assessments?
The First Grade Benchmark Assessments serve a vital role in evaluating early literacy skills. Designed specifically for first graders, these assessments help educators identify key areas of literacy development. They encompass sections such as Letter Naming Fluency and Letter Sound Fluency, which provide insights into a student’s reading capabilities. The results are crucial for assessing student progress and tailoring further educational interventions.

Key Features of the First Grade Benchmark Assessments
The First Grade Benchmark Assessments include several important components that enhance their utility. These features facilitate data collection and analysis, ensuring accurate and efficient results. Key elements of the form encompass:
-
Fillable fields such as 'Given To', 'School', and performance metrics.
-
A one-minute timeframe for assessments, emphasizing both validity and reliability.
-
A structured layout that simplifies data entry and review processes.
